About
Brodie Animal Hospital provides comprehensive veterinary care for pets in Austin, TX, and has been serving the community since 1987. The clinic is a full-service general practice offering wellness and preventive medicine, diagnostic testing, advanced care, and surgical procedures. They are also a Cat Friendly Certified® Practice, which aims to reduce stress for cats during veterinary visits.
The hospital is an American Animal Hospital Association (AAHA) accredited facility, meaning it meets or exceeds AAHA's standards of care in areas such as surgery, patient care, cleanliness, and emergency services. They offer urgent care services and emphasize early detection and treatment in their approach to pet health.

Frequently asked questions
- What certifications does Brodie Animal Hospital hold?
- Brodie Animal Hospital is a Cat Friendly Certified® Practice, established by the American Association of Feline Practitioners (AAFP) and the International Society for Feline Medicine (ISFM). Additionally, it is an American Animal Hospital Association (AAHA) accredited facility, recognized for meeting or exceeding AAHA's standards of care.
- What types of diagnostic services are available at Brodie Animal Hospital?
- Brodie Animal Hospital offers a range of diagnostic services including blood and lab tests, veterinary radiology (X-rays) for detailed images of bones and internal structures, ultrasound for real-time viewing of internal organs, and tonometry to measure eye pressure. They also perform electrocardiograms (ECG) to record the electrical activity of a pet's heart.
- What preventive care services does Brodie Animal Hospital offer?
- The clinic provides comprehensive wellness and prevention services including routine nose-to-tail wellness exams, vaccinations tailored to a pet's age and lifestyle, year-round parasite control, and microchipping. They also offer pet dental care, nutrition guidance, and specific care programs for puppies, kittens, and senior pets.
- Does Brodie Animal Hospital provide care for pet allergies and skin conditions?
- Yes, Brodie Animal Hospital diagnoses and manages a wide range of dermatologic conditions, including allergies, infections, parasites, and inflammatory skin disease. They provide veterinary evaluations for pets showing signs of itching, irritation, hair loss, or recurring ear issues.
